What Is Front End Development – Understanding the Role of a Front-End Developer
The Beginner’s Guide to Front-End Development: Demystifying the Basics
Understanding the Role of a Front-End Developer
Front-end development is like designing the exterior of a building. It’s what people see and interact with when they visit a website. Just as a well-designed building exterior attracts visitors, a well-crafted front-end design enhances the user experience and keeps visitors engaged.
The Core Programming Languages of Front-End Development
HTML (HyperText Markup Language)
HTML forms the foundation of any web page. It provides the structure and content of the page, defining the elements like headings, paragraphs, images, and links.
CSS (Cascading Style Sheets)
CSS is responsible for the visual presentation of a web page. It controls the layout, colors, fonts, and overall style, making the web page visually appealing and responsive to different devices.
Frameworks And Tools Used In Front-End Development
Front-end developers often use frameworks like Bootstrap, jQuery, and React to streamline the development process and create responsive, feature-rich web applications. These tools provide pre-built components and libraries, saving time and effort while ensuring a consistent and professional user interface.
JQuery Use for Front-End Developer Roles To Manage the DOM
JQuery is a versatile tool commonly used by Front-End Developers to enhance website interactivity and user experience. It simplifies tasks like event handling, animation, and AJAX calls by providing a smooth and concise syntax that makes coding more efficient.
Front-End Developers often utilize JQuery to manipulate HTML elements via the DOM (Document Object Model), dynamically update content, and create engaging animations to bring web pages to life.
With its vast library of plugins and functions, JQuery empowers developers to easily incorporate interactive features into their projects, ultimately delivering a more engaging and responsive user interface.
Overall, JQuery is a valuable asset for Front-End Developers, enabling them to streamline development processes and create visually appealing websites with enhanced functionality.
How Bootstrap is used by Front-end Developers for responsive sites
Bootstrap is a lifesaver for Front-End Developers! This powerful front-end framework offers a plethora of pre-made templates, styles, and components that can be easily implemented to create stunning websites without starting from scratch.
By using Bootstrap’s grid system, responsive design becomes a breeze, ensuring that websites look great on any device. Its extensive documentation and community support make it a go-to tool for developers, allowing them to streamline the development process and focus on building user-friendly interfaces.
With Bootstrap, Front-End Developers can quickly create professional-looking websites while saving time and effort, making it an essential resource in their toolkit.
Career Opportunities in Web Development
Front-end developers are in high demand across industries, as businesses recognize the importance of a compelling and user-friendly web presence. With the rapid growth of technology, front-end development offers promising career prospects and opportunities for continuous learning and skill enhancement.
Salary and Career Growth – The Job of Front End Development
Front-end developers can expect competitive salaries, with average annual salaries varying depending on factors like experience and location. According to several sources such as Glass Door, Indeed, and Morgan McKinley, the average salary of a front-end developer ranges from 35,000 – 80,000 per year. As you gain experience and expertise in front-end development, you can explore opportunities for career growth, including becoming a full-stack developer or pursuing a specialized role in the field.
Embracing the Journey – Become a Front-End Developer
Front-end development is an exciting and dynamic field that welcomes beginners with a passion for creativity and problem-solving. By mastering the fundamentals and staying updated with the latest trends and technologies, aspiring front-end developers can embark on a fulfilling and rewarding journey in the world of web development.
Front-end development may seem daunting at first, but with dedication and practice, beginners can grasp the essential concepts and skills to build visually stunning and functional websites that captivate and delight users.
Front-end development is the gateway to creating captivating and responsive web experiences. By mastering the core languages, exploring various tools and frameworks, and embracing the opportunities in the field, beginners can kickstart their journey with confidence and enthusiasm.
Q: What is front end development?
Q: What is the role of a front-end developer?
Q: What tools are commonly used by front end developers?
A: Front end developers often use tools like jQuery, Bootstrap, XML, DOM manipulation, and AJAX to create responsive and interactive websites.
Q: How can someone become a front end developer?
Q: What is the average salary of a front-end developer?
A: The average salary of a front-end developer can vary depending on factors such as experience, location, and the specific industry. However, front-end developers typically earn competitive salaries in the tech industry.
Q: What is the difference between front-end and back-end development?
A: Front-end development focuses on the visual and interactive aspects of a website that users see and interact with, while back-end development involves the server-side programming and database management that powers the website. Front-end developers work on creating the user interface, while back-end developers handle the behind-the-scenes functionalities.
Q: What are some key skills required to excel as a front end developer?
I am a self-motivated, passionate website designer and developer. I have over ten years’ experience in building websites and have developed a broad skill set including web design, frontend and backend development, and SEO.
Using my growing knowledge base I have built my own company (scriptedart.co.uk) creating websites and ecommerce stores and producing custom graphics and web app functionality for a range of local businesses.